So value your skin in this humid monsoon weather because like the rain seems beautiful, you should also be beautiful. Here are some tips that help you to project your skin from this harsh weather:

  • Cleansing in monsoon: Once you exfoliate well, cleanse the open pores and allow your skin to breath. You can use coconut oil, tea tree oil, apple cider vinegar, aloe Vera, honey and lemon.

 

  • Exfoliating in monsoon: Exfoliation removes dead skin and unclog pores. It also helps in growth of new skin cells giving you a glowing skin. Some of the best exfoliators are coffee, teabag, sugar, baking soda, papaya, oatmeal and yogurt. Make sure that you exfoliate with these mildly abrasive ingredients.

 

  • Toning in monsoon: Tone your skin to remove the leftover dirt and makeup. Store bought toners may not be great, but can use natural things like green tea, lemon juice, rose water and cucumber water for toning your skin.

 

  • Moisturizing your skin: The last and final step includes moisturizing as it is important to keep your skin hydrated and soft. Some of the natural moisturizers are cucumber, coconut oil, Hemp seed oil and olive oil.

 

  • Make sure that you wash your face, feet and hands with lukewarm water as it protects you from the bacteria and other infections. It also helps in opening your skin pores and cleaning it properly and reduces the chances of pimples and acne also.

 

  • Make sure that you use soap-free cleansers to keep your skin moisturizers. Soap free cleanser helps in retention of required oil in the skin by removing excess oil gently. It helps in making the skin hydrated in monsoon.

 

  • Keep your skin and body clean by waxing, manicures and pedicures. They help in making your body clean and away from dirt and bacteria due to humid weather. This also helps in making you feel dry and odorless.

 

  • Tomatoes for skin: Tomato juice is can be applied on the skin to keep your skin look fresh, hydrated and rejuvenated. Apply tomatoes after grating it on the skin and let it dry for some time. Then wash this pack after it is dry.

 

  • Water for glowing skin: One must drink a lot of water in order to make your skin hydrated and flush away all the toxins which accumulate inside your body. At least eat ten to eight glass of water should be intake by your body.

 

  • Keep an eye on your diet: Your diet always reflects on your skin. So, never follow an improper diet. More intake of fresh vegetables and fruit helps the skin remaining healthy throughout the year. Therefore, one must have the habit of eating fresh fruits and vegetables.
